United Performing Arts Fund has earned a coveted 4-star rating on Charity Navigator. Receiving four out of a possible four stars indicates that our organization adheres to good governance and other best practices that minimize the chance of unethical activities and that we consistently execute our mission in a fiscally responsible way.

Set in present day Paris, Art begins as Serge buys an extremely expensive painting - which is rather minimalist in style. He never suspects how much the purchase will strain his friendship with Marc and Yvan - testing their relationship to the max.
 

Director Tyler Marchant has loved the play Art since he first became familiar with it.

Tigers Be Still is a comedy that follows the misadventures of Sherry, a young woman with a master's degree in art therapy, only to find herself moving back home with her family, sending out countless résumés and waiting for the job offer that never comes. Unemployed and overwhelmed, she retreats to her childhood bed and remains there until an unexpected employment opportunity gives her a renewed sense of purpose and hope. Now, if only her mother (unseen) would come downstairs, her boozing sister would get off the couch, her very first therapy patient would do just one of his take-home assignments, her new boss -- and former Principal -- would leave his gun at home, and someone would catch the tiger that escaped from the local zoo, everything would be just perfect.
